On-campus Steam Plant Fuels Big Savings
The Story:
Back in 1988, the decision to build an on-campus steam plant
was made. Twenty years later, it has proved to be a smart
investment. While oil is still used to supplement the wood
boiler in times of high demand and during the summer months,
about 78 per cent of the steam produced is thanks to wood.
The Numbers:
- Total money saved since 1988:
$4,243,863.95
- Fuel saved last year by burning wood: 1,255,000
liters
- Total CO2 diverted: 3,989,645 kg CO2
Note: an NSAC heating season is from September to May
Source: http://www.carbontrust.co.uk/resource/conversion_factors/default.htm
The Facts:
- One car puts out approximately 7,700 kg CO2 a year
- The amount
of CO2 NSAC saves by not burning fuel is equivalent to
removing approximately 518 cars from the road for
one year
